Carcar city: 2 dead, 1 injured in road accident

Rowena D. Capistrano - The Freeman

CEBU, Philippines - Two people died while another was injured when a Mitsubishi Montero collided with a truck in Barangay Ocaña in Carcar City Friday.

The fatalities were identified as  Rogelio Nelmida, 55, driver of the Mazda truck, and a certain Dioscoro Aliser. Injured was Nelmida's wife Maria Luz.

The Montero driver was identified as Jesus Ybañez, 55, a resident of Barangay Mojon, Talisay City.

According to Police Officer 1 Regie Amad of Carcar City Police Station, based on initial investigation, Ybañez was driving a white Montero when he spotted a man, who was reportedly drunk, walking aimlessly on the road and tried to avoid him.

However, he ended up still hitting the victim, who was later identified as Aliser, resulting to the latter's death.

After accidentally hitting Aliser, Ybañez' car overshot the road and bumped into Nelmida's truck, which was traveling the opposite direction.

Due to the impact, Nelmida was seriously injured and died immediately, said Amad.

Nelmida's wife was also injured and was brought to the hospital.

"Grabe sab nga kadaut nahiaguman sa sakyanan ni Nelmida, mao'y naingnan sa kamatayon niini ug pagkaangol sa iyang asawa nga gidala sa tambalanan," said Amad.

According to Amad, Ybañez came from Argao and was going home in Talisay City while the Nelmida couple came from Lapu-Lapu City and was going home to Barangay Napo in Carcar City when the accident happened.

Amad said during the investigation, Ybañez alleged that he lost control of the car when he tried to avoid the drunk man.

Ybañez is temporarily held at the Carcar City Police Station and will face charges for reckless imprudence resulting to multiple homicide, physical injuries and damage to property. (FREEMAN)

Construction worker “robs,” “stabs” taxi driver in Mandaue

Maureen Jay Intrampas

CEBU, Philippines - A 26-year-old construction worker was arrested for allegedly robbing and attempting to kill a taxi driver yesterday along G. Ouano Street in Barangay Alang-Alang, Mandaue City.

Suspect Jimboy Esnardo of Barangay Pajo, Lapu-Lapu City allegedly tried to kill Core Nudalo, 41, driver of Holiday Taxi, after the driver fought during the robbery.

According to Police Officer 2 Jason Flor of Centro Police Station, the suspect flagged down the taxi at his workplace at Menzi Building in Barangay Pajo and asked the driver to be brought home.

But upon reaching Barangay Alang-Alang, the suspect allegedly declared a holdup and told the driver "Nagkinahanglan kog kwarta bay (I need money)" while pointing at him a knife.

However, the driver fought with him.

The suspect managed to stab the driver on his head but the latter eventually got hold of him.

Policemen responded and arrested the suspect.

At the police station, the suspect denied robbing the driver, saying they were arguing over the direction.

He said the driver was taking the wrong direction in bringing him home, which irked and led him in stabbing the victim.

"Wala man ko mangawat ma'am. Gapahatod man ko ato's taxi unya 'taka man og hunong mao 'to nag-away 'mi," he said.

Aside from the knife, a small pack of suspected shabu was also reportedly seized from the suspect.

This was also denied by the suspect.

"Pataka man lang na sila. Wa man ko kita nga naa sila'y nakuha gikan sa bulsa nga shabu. Wa man ko'y shabu," he said.

The driver, a resident of Barangay Subangdaku, Mandaue City, had his minor stab wound to the head. — (FREEMAN)
